Райтапы по CTF{2025}
2.83K subscribers
215 photos
25 videos
87 files
393 links
☺️ Уютное сообщество для публикации райтапов с разных CTF соревнований и платформ

💬 Наш ламповый чатик: @writeup_chat

✍️ По любому вопросу можно писать мне: @freenameruuuu

Таски решать тут: @writeup_ctf_bot
Download Telegram
Очередной райтап от рок-звезды нашего канала @Max_RSC

Привет! Я обещал прислать райтапы на интересные таски со SpookyCTF. Сначала хотел прислать ссылки на чужие райтапы, а потом подумал – почему бы не написать самому, если я могу сделать лучше? Первый райтап:


#misc #SpookyCTF2024
the-true-bloop

Нам предоставлен зашифрованный флаг, который, как сообщает автор таска, зашифрован с использованием шифра Виженера. Кроме того, прикреплены четыре аудиофайла (1.wav, 2.wav, 3.wav, 4.wav), которые, надо понимать, каким-то образом помогут нам определить ключ.

Зашифрованный флаг выглядит следующим образом:

g4ed_j05_dX_b0Ww0q_0f_wu4rcK

Поскольку таск относится к категории misc, можно сделать вывод, что в данном случае не требуется выполнение криптоанализа. Следовательно, аудиофайлы – ключ к разгадке.

После прослушивания аудиофайлов мы замечаем, что звуки различаются по высоте, при этом первый и четвертый звуки являются идентичными. Однако, diff сообщает о том, что файлы различаются:
diff 1.wav 4.wav

# Binary files 1.wav and 4.wav differ

По-видимому, это было сделано с целью запутать решающего.

Я уверен, что многие подумали о спектрограммах или SSTV, но это не тот случай, и именно по этой причине таск привлек мое внимание.

Внимательно прослушав аудиофайлы, я сделал предположение, что первый и второй звуки различаются на тон. Используя программу Sonic Visualiser, я проверил их частоты и обнаружил следующее: первый (и четвертый) звуки имеют частоту 293 Гц, второй — 329 Гц, а третий — 440 Гц. Здесь полезно вспомнить, что 440 Гц — это международный стандарт настройки музыкальных инструментов, который определяет частоту ноты A4 (ля первой октавы). Таким образом, я предположил, что наши "таинственные" звуки — это ноты, и оказался прав: первый звук соответствует ноте D4 (ре первой октавы), второй — E4 (ми первой октавы), а третий — A4 (ля первой октавы). Интервал между нотами D (ре) и E (ми) составляет целый тон — мое предположение оказалось верным.

Поскольку первый и четвертый звуки одинаковы, это дает нам слово "DEAD" (D4 + E4 + A4 + D4).

Далее все достаточно очевидно: мы используем любой онлайн-расшифровщик для шифра Виженера и расшифровываем флаг, применив полученный ключ.
🔥118
🧐 # Навигация и теги для поиска райтапов в канале

1️⃣ прошедшие CTF
#HackOSINT2024, #kubanctf2024, #КубокCTF2024, #RedShift2024, #SpookyCTF2024, #чемпионатпервенство2024, #VolgaCTF_2025 #tctf2025

2️⃣ CTF платформы
#standoff365, #codebygames, #taipanbyte, #polyctf

3️⃣таски от подписчиков
бот в котором собраны все задачи, где их можно решать и получать баллы: @writeup_ctf_bot
#таск@writeup_ctf

🐱 БОНУС
#рекомендация@writeup_ctf #мемы, #полезное

💬 Канал & Чат | 📺 RUTUBE | 📺 YouTube

По вопросикам и предложениям пишите мне @freenameruuuu
обнял и жму краба
🦞
Please open Telegram to view this post
VIEW IN TELEGRAM
🔥111